Jinlong Ma is a scholar working on Public Health, Environmental and Occupational Health, Reproductive Medicine and Molecular Biology. According to data from OpenAlex, Jinlong Ma has authored 107 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 42 papers in Public Health, Environmental and Occupational Health, 37 papers in Reproductive Medicine and 34 papers in Molecular Biology. Recurrent topics in Jinlong Ma's work include Reproductive Biology and Fertility (33 papers), Ovarian function and disorders (24 papers) and Reproductive System and Pregnancy (18 papers). Jinlong Ma is often cited by papers focused on Reproductive Biology and Fertility (33 papers), Ovarian function and disorders (24 papers) and Reproductive System and Pregnancy (18 papers). Jinlong Ma collaborates with scholars based in China, United States and Hong Kong. Jinlong Ma's co-authors include Zi‐Jiang Chen, Hongbin Liu, Yingying Qin, Linlin Cui, Tao Huang, Zheng Ge, Han Zhao, Jingmei Hu, Shigang Zhao and Shidou Zhao and has published in prestigious journals such as PLoS ONE, Advanced Functional Materials and Journal of Cleaner Production.
